By virtue of the authority vested by the Constitution of Virginia in the Governor of the Commonwealth of Virginia, there is hereby officially recognized:

Virginia Pumpkin Month

WHEREAS, Virginia farmers harvested 4,200 acres of pumpkins with fresh market production valued at $11.9 million in 2022; and

WHEREAS, an increasing number of Virginia farmers have effectively utilized the Commonwealth’s favorable environment for growing pumpkins, taking advantage of higher elevations and cooler temperatures to produce a high-value crop beloved by consumers; and

WHEREAS, Virginia ranks 10th nationally in pumpkin cash receipts, thanks to the nearly 400 commercial pumpkin growers across the Commonwealth; and

WHEREAS, pumpkins are rich in vitamins, minerals, and antioxidants to boost immune systems, protect eyesight, lower the risk of certain cancers, and promote heart and skin health; and

WHEREAS, pick-your-own pumpkin farms provide a family-friendly, outdoor experience that showcases Virginia farms and agritourism enterprises; and

WHEREAS, the marketing of pumpkins, related fall crops and other merchandise through festivals, direct sales, and buyer contacts, along with the expanded production of pumpkins in recent years, provide an additional income stream for many of Virginia’s agricultural producers and supports the agriculture industry overall; and

WHEREAS, Pumpkin Month is an opportunity to acknowledge the work of those who cultivate and harvest pumpkins and the value of pumpkins to Virginians;

NOW, THEREFORE, I, Glenn Youngkin, do hereby recognize October 2023, as PUMPKIN MONTH in the COMMONWEALTH OF VIRGINIA, and I call this observance to the attention of all our citizens.
